// Code generated by applyconfiguration-gen. DO NOT EDIT.
package v1
// WorkloadReferenceApplyConfiguration represents a declarative configuration of the WorkloadReference type for use
// with apply.
//
// WorkloadReference identifies the Workload object and PodGroup membership
// that a Pod belongs to. The scheduler uses this information to apply
// workload-aware scheduling semantics.
type WorkloadReferenceApplyConfiguration struct {
// Name defines the name of the Workload object this Pod belongs to.
// Workload must be in the same namespace as the Pod.
// If it doesn't match any existing Workload, the Pod will remain unschedulable
// until a Workload object is created and observed by the kube-scheduler.
// It must be a DNS subdomain.
Name *string `json:"name,omitempty"`
// PodGroup is the name of the PodGroup within the Workload that this Pod
// belongs to. If it doesn't match any existing PodGroup within the Workload,
// the Pod will remain unschedulable until the Workload object is recreated
// and observed by the kube-scheduler. It must be a DNS label.
PodGroup *string `json:"podGroup,omitempty"`
// PodGroupReplicaKey specifies the replica key of the PodGroup to which this
// Pod belongs. It is used to distinguish pods belonging to different replicas
// of the same pod group. The pod group policy is applied separately to each replica.
// When set, it must be a DNS label.
PodGroupReplicaKey *string `json:"podGroupReplicaKey,omitempty"`
}
// WorkloadReferenceApplyConfiguration constructs a declarative configuration of the WorkloadReference type for use with
// apply.
func WorkloadReference() *WorkloadReferenceApplyConfiguration {
return &WorkloadReferenceApplyConfiguration{}
}
// WithName sets the Name field in the declarative configuration to the given value
// and returns the receiver, so that objects can be built by chaining "With" function invocations.
// If called multiple times, the Name field is set to the value of the last call.
func (b *WorkloadReferenceApplyConfiguration) WithName(value string) *WorkloadReferenceApplyConfiguration {
b.Name = &value
return b
}
// WithPodGroup sets the PodGroup field in the declarative configuration to the given value
// and returns the receiver, so that objects can be built by chaining "With" function invocations.
// If called multiple times, the PodGroup field is set to the value of the last call.
func (b *WorkloadReferenceApplyConfiguration) WithPodGroup(value string) *WorkloadReferenceApplyConfiguration {
b.PodGroup = &value
return b
}
// WithPodGroupReplicaKey sets the PodGroupReplicaKey field in the declarative configuration to the given value
// and returns the receiver, so that objects can be built by chaining "With" function invocations.
// If called multiple times, the PodGroupReplicaKey field is set to the value of the last call.
func (b *WorkloadReferenceApplyConfiguration) WithPodGroupReplicaKey(value string) *WorkloadReferenceApplyConfiguration {
b.PodGroupReplicaKey = &value
return b
}
